Understanding the Ratchet And Pawl Mechanism
The Ratchet And Pawl mechanism consists of two main components: the ratchet wheel and the pawl. The ratchet wheel is a circular gear with teeth that are designed to engage with the pawl. The pawl is a spring-loaded lever that fits into the teeth of the ratchet wheel, allowing motion in one direction while preventing it in the opposite direction.
This mechanism is often used in devices where a continuous, unidirectional motion is required. For example, in a clock, the Ratchet And Pawl system ensures that the clock hands move forward without reversing. Similarly, in machinery, it prevents the backlash that can occur due to sudden changes in direction or load.

How the Ratchet And Pawl Mechanism Works
The operation of the Ratchet And Pawl mechanism is relatively simple yet highly effective. Here’s a step-by-step explanation of how it works:
- Engagement: The pawl engages with the teeth of the ratchet wheel, allowing motion in one direction.
- Motion Control: As the ratchet wheel rotates, the pawl slides over the teeth, preventing backward motion.
- Spring Action: The spring ensures that the pawl remains in contact with the ratchet wheel, maintaining the engagement.
- Directional Control: The pawl’s design allows it to move over the teeth in one direction while locking in the opposite direction.
This process ensures that the mechanism only allows motion in one direction, providing precise control and preventing backlash.

Design Considerations for the Ratchet And Pawl Mechanism
When designing a Ratchet And Pawl mechanism, several factors need to be considered to ensure optimal performance:
- Material Selection: Choose materials that can withstand the expected load and environmental conditions.
- Tooth Design: The design of the teeth on the ratchet wheel and the pawl should be optimized for the specific application.
- Spring Force: The spring force should be sufficient to keep the pawl engaged with the ratchet wheel but not so strong that it causes excessive wear.
- Housing Design: The housing should provide adequate support and stability for the mechanism.
By carefully considering these factors, engineers can design a Ratchet And Pawl mechanism that meets the specific requirements of their application.
